tpwallet最新版USDT打包失败:全面分析与解决方案

背景与问题描述\n\ntpwallet作为多链资产管理的移动钱包,在最新版中对USDT的打包能力遭遇失败,引发了用户和开发者的广泛关注。USDT本身在不同链上存在多种实现:以太坊ERC-20、波场TRC-20、比特币的Omni、以及后续的Solana、Avalanche等跨链版本。打包失败通常不是单点故障,而是跨链适配、签名流程、资产对齐、以及后端聚合逻辑的综合问题。\n\n常见根因包括:1) 链上合约地址、代币精度小数点设置与钱包内部一致性问题;2) 签名序列化与 nonce/gas 的错位,导致交易被拒绝或丢弃;3) 后端聚合服务在请求打包时未能正确组装多个输入输出,产生不一致的事务图;4) 新版本升级引入的状态机冲突或兼容性问题;5) 链上网络拥塞导致等待超时与重试策略触发。\n\n在缺省场景中,用户看到的通常是“打包失败/ pending”的状态,随后要么被厂商自动回滚要么进入失败日志,进而触发重试。针对这一现象,需要从支付解决方案、技术创新、评估、交易明细、共识机制与代币分配等维度进行系统排查与改进。\n\n\n高级支付解决方案\n\n- 多链聚合与分布式路由:通过统一的支付网关对接ERC-20/TRC-20/SOL等版本的USDT,并使用多路由策略将资金从来源链转移至目标链的最优路径,以降低单点故障的风险。\n- 离线签名与在线提交组合:支持离线签名笔记,在移动端完成离线签名后将签名片段提交回后端进行打包,降低敏感私钥泄露风险,同时提升响应性。\n- 回滚与幂等设计:在检测到打包异常时,提供幂等处理、状态回滚和重试策略,确保多次请求不会产生重复交易或资金错配。\n- 跨链桥与代币映射:对于需要跨链转移USDT的场景,采用经过审计的跨链桥方案,确保跨链映射的一致性。\n\n\n先进科技创新\n\n- MPC密钥管理:通过多方计算实现私钥的分

作者:Alex Chen发布时间:2025-09-27 21:05:03

评论

CryptoNinja77

这篇分析把打包失败的根因讲得很清晰,实战很有用,尤其是对跨链路由和幂等性的解读。

静默观察者

很好地把技术细节和业务场景结合起来,提出了可操作的改进点,值得开发团队参考。

QuantumPhaser

从共识机制角度的解释很直观,帮助我们理解不同链对同一USDT版本的影响。

数码旅者

希望加入更多交易日志示例和失败排查清单,便于运维团队快速定位问题。

相关阅读
<time dir="9i6j1"></time><legend dir="ogu9b"></legend><area lang="w7fef"></area><dfn id="mcvw2"></dfn><address dropzone="neyrb"></address><del draggable="k8pdd"></del><kbd lang="k_cjq"></kbd>